For high-volume cafeterias and busy foodservice lines where speed and durability matter, this mobile plate dispenser offers organized, accessible plate storage in a compact footprint. It ships freestanding and runs on 120v power while remaining unheated, so operators avoid added complexity and energy draw; the unit’s open-base design simplifies under-unit cleaning and keeps service areas sanitary. Four Compartments The dispenser divides plate inventory into four dedicated compartments to separate sizes or courses, enabling faster selection during peak service periods and reducing cross-contamination risk. Open Base An open-style base provides unobstructed access for floor cleaning and mop-through sanitation procedures, supporting compliance with routine health inspections and reducing time spent on maintenance. Freestanding Installation You can place the unit where workflow requires it because freestanding installation removes the need for permanent anchoring, allowing quick reconfiguration of serving lines or catering setups. Unheated Operation Operating without heat preserves plate integrity and eliminates the need for thermal controls, so staff can use the dispenser in chilled or ambient environments without concern for temperature regulation. Mobile Design Designed for mobility, the unit moves between stations to match service demands, minimizing plate transport and streamlining tray assembly or plating steps in high-turnover operations. 120v Compatibility The dispenser accepts standard 120 volts to integrate into existing kitchen circuits without electrical upgrades, simplifying installation and reducing upfront infrastructure costs. LongDescription#@#NA#@@#Cleaning Instructions#@#Unplug the Piper Products 4ATG4 Plate Dispenser and remove all plates. Wipe interior surfaces with a mild detergent and warm water, using a soft cloth to avoid scratches. Clean each of the four compartments thoroughly, removing debris and dry with a lint-free towel. Vacuum or brush the open base to clear dust and crumbs. Sanitize food-contact surfaces per your protocol and let air-dry before reassembly. Inspect moving parts for wear and tighten fasteners as needed.#@@#Additional Info#@#The Piper Products 4ATG4 Plate Dispenser is a freestanding, unheated unit with four compartments for plate storage.
